A strategic framework for green industrialisation
Namibia aims to build complete value chains connecting renewable power, water treatment, electrolysis, processing, storage, transport and export infrastructure.
The strategy supports investment, technological innovation, local employment, industrial value creation and access to domestic and international hydrogen markets.
Namibia’s Green Hydrogen and Derivatives Strategy, launched in 2022, establishes a national framework for renewable hydrogen, green ammonia and related industries.

RENEWABLE ENERGY POTENTIAL
Namibia has some of the world’s strongest renewable energy resources
More than 300 sunny days in many regions, with solar irradiation reaching nearly 3,000 kWh/m² annually.
Coastal wind complements daytime solar production and supports hydrogen generation
during periods of lower sunlight.
Combining solar, wind and battery storage creates a more reliable electricity supply and improves electrolyzer utilisation.

GREEN HYDROGEN PRODUCTION
Green Hydrogen Production & Supply
Water Sourcing
Green hydrogen production begins with responsible water sourcing and renewable electricity, followed by purification, electrolysis, storage and distribution.
For coastal projects, seawater can provide the primary water source while protecting community, agricultural and ecological needs.
Collected hydrogen can support industry, mobility, ports and rail, or be converted into green ammonia, green iron and electricity.
Desalination & Purification
Reverse osmosis removes salt, minerals and impurities, producing purified water suitable for electrolysis and responsible hydrogen production.
Hydrogen Production
Renewable-powered electrolyzers separate purified water into hydrogen and oxygen before compression, storage or conversion into green derivatives.
